Hollywood actor John Travolta has become the latest star to join the publishing world, with a tell-all book about his life.
The Pulp Fiction star's representatives have reportedly been calling publishing houses to set up meetings between the 50-year-old actor and editors.
A source tells MSNBC's website: "Someone called and asked if I'd be interested in meeting with John Travolta. Now I have to whip out some of my old Saturday Night Fever-inspired outfits."
The source adds it's "highly unusual" for a celebrity of Travolta's calibre to be writing a book about his life, explaining: "Usually, it's the lesser stars or someone in the twilight of his career or country and western stars.
"He certainly has an interesting story to tell."
